Ion thrusters with controlled thrust vector

Project description

Development, testing and implementation of modern electric motors for spacecraft. The focus is on electric motors with thrust vector control (EPT with TVC), which provide high—precision maneuvering, orbital maintenance and interorbital maneuvers. The technology makes it possible to create engines for both small and large spacecraft.

Target outcome

Creation of reliable and efficient thrust vector-controlled electric motors for small and medium-sized satellites, which will reduce the cost and enhance the functionality of the satellites. The launch of mass production of several models for different types of spacecraft by 2028.

Stage

Pre-series. BDEPT successfully passed flight tests in 2023. MTVEPT was launched into space in November 2024, and performance is being confirmed. CRST is scheduled to be launched in 2025.

Roadmap

2025 Q1

CRST Launch

A new type of thrust vectoring engine in 6 directions

2025 Q2

Testing MTVEPT

Enlarged fuel tanks, new type of RF generator

2025 Q3

Scaling up production

Creation of serial solutions for small satellites

2025 Q3–Q4

Commercial missions

Using thrusters to support missions with precise maneuvers

2025 Q4

Publishing the results

Technology promotion through international conferences
